Situation
Located to the west of Dunfermline, the village of Cairneyhill is a much sought after residential village that enjoys a semi -rural location that offers a selection of local shops, bars and schooling at nursery and primary level. There is a wider selection of shops, bars, restaurants, churches, cinema and recreational amenities available in nearby Dunfermline. The village is a popular commuter base offering access to the Forth and Kincardine Bridges, the motorway network and beyond, with park 'n' ride facilities available via the rail network in nearby Dunfermline. There is also a local bus service available to Dunfermline and beyond.
